    Guys give a try to disable HDR on your console, and also change the resolution to 1080p instead default.
    With or without HDR my ps5 has still crashed. Reinstalled DT. I took my resolution to 1080p without the HDR on and look like ps3 era washed-out ugly and with jagged edges. Other settings may have crashed my ps5 but it was pretty to look at. I changed so many setting tried, so many things yet nothing has work. I might have to just wait for a hotfix or launch.
    yes 120hz is off been asked more times then I like today< small vent

    UPDATE: in the game setting turn on fame rate to 30 fps this fixed my over heating/hard crash issue. And I set my graphic back to 4k played for few hrs in the Tural doing cs, walking around areas in the city with lots of people no crash.
    My fc leader looked around the jp forums saw some post 30 fps as bandaid solution until this gets patched.
    I hope this fix works for others.

    So I was able to chat with SE support and after a very short wait was told to try bunch of things. My ps5 is still crashing from over heating. Please more people file a bug reports it could help.

    Anyway this is what I was told to do and it did not fix it.

    Troubleshooting steps.

    1. is to clear the cache on the console:
    - Turn off the console by holding the power button for three seconds. The power indicator will blink before switching off.
    - Once the system is off, press and hold the button down until you hear it beep twice.
    - After the system turns on, connect the controller via USB and press the PS button.
    - On the Safe Mode menu, select 'Clear Cache and Rebuild Database'.
    - Please select 'Clear System Software Cache' to clear the system's cache.


    If it crashes again, just try to follow the next steps below:

    2) Rebuilding the Database:

    - Turn off the console by holding the power button for three seconds. The power indicator will blink before switching off.
    - Once the system is off, press and hold the button down until you hear it beep twice. after the system turns on, connect the controller via USB and press the PS button.
    - On the Safe Mode menu, select 'Clear Cache and Rebuild Database'.
    - Please select 'Rebuild Database' to rebuild the system’s database.

    3) Clearing Cookies and Web Browser settings:

    - Select 'Settings' from the main menu and navigate to 'System'.
    - Once there, click 'Web Browser'.
    - To clear cookies, please select 'Delete Cookies'.
    - To clear the browsing data, please select 'Clear Website Data'.
    - Double check to see if JavaScript is enable by selecting the slider next to 'Enable JavaScript'.

    Port-Forwarding the PlayStation 5:

    4)- Check the following Port Ranges on your router/modem to ensure that the following Port Ranges have been opened/forwarded/triggered:

    ▼TCP
    54992 through 54994,
    55006 through 55007,
    55021 through 55040

    *This can be done by visiting www.portforward.com, locate your specific Router/Modem Brand and Model Number from the 'List of Routers', and you will find a step-by-step guide on how to access your ports.

    5) If the issue is still not resolved, there may be an issue with the hardware or OS of your PlayStation 5. For further assistance, please contact PlayStation Support here: https://support.us.playstation.com

    1-3 I did, 4 is not my issue and well 5 I will have to file report. No other game is making my ps5 hard crash. The suggestions are helpful but feel more like a default answer.


    30fps seems be the only thing working. I can play for hours on 30fps but once that's off Hard crashing every 30 mins or so. Really don't want to play at 30fps and I wasn't before Dawntrail.
